ClassLoader类使用委托模型来搜索类和资源
每个ClassLoader实例都有一个相关的类加载器。需要查找类或资源时,ClassLoader实例在试图亲自查找类或资源之前,将搜索类和资源的任务委托给器父类加载器。
虚拟机的内置类加载器(称为“Bootstrap class loader”)本身没有父类加载器。
但是可以将它作为ClassLoader实例的父类加载器。
类加载过程
比如app类在加载之前,会先让父类加载app类,如果父类没有响应的加载器,在自己加载。
ClassLoader类使用委托模型来搜索类和资源
每个ClassLoader实例都有一个相关的类加载器。需要查找类或资源时,ClassLoader实例在试图亲自查找类或资源之前,将搜索类和资源的任务委托给器父类加载器。
虚拟机的内置类加载器(称为“Bootstrap class loader”)本身没有父类加载器。
但是可以将它作为ClassLoader实例的父类加载器。
类加载过程
比如app类在加载之前,会先让父类加载app类,如果父类没有响应的加载器,在自己加载。